A federal jury convicts Kim Taylor in an Iowa absentee-ballot scheme
A federal jury convicted Kim Phuong Taylor on 52 counts tied to voter registrations, absentee-ballot requests, and absentee ballots in Iowa's 2020 primary and general elections. Prosecutors said Taylor generated votes for her husband, Jeremy Taylor, during his Republican congressional primary and Woodbury County supervisor campaigns. The case involved dozens of forms and ballots, making it larger than the one-ballot cases that dominate voter-fraud prosecutions.
